Is Bronson, MI a Good Place to Live?
Bronson receives an overall livability grade of B+ (74/100), indicating solid livability relative to the rest of Michigan. Safety scores B+ (73/100). Affordability scores B+ (75/100) with a median household income of $64,962 and median home values around $124,100.
About 11.3% of residents hold a bachelor's degree or higher, and the unemployment rate is 2.5%. 79% of housing is owner-occupied. The median age is 40.
